feat(core): single-source data_dir/repos_dir via castle.yaml
The `castle` CLI and the `castle-api` service are two independent in-process drivers of `castle_core`. Each resolved DATA_DIR/REPOS_DIR at import time from its own process env (default /data/castle), persisted nowhere — so they silently diverged, and `apply`/dashboard-apply crashed on a non-existent /data. Make the loaded CastleConfig the single source of truth: - Resolve data_dir/repos_dir only in load_config (env > castle.yaml > default), anchored to the config root; drop the DATA_DIR/REPOS_DIR module globals and the import-time file read entirely — no global twin that can disagree with the file. - Thread config.data_dir/repos_dir through ensure_dirs, _env_context, tls_dir_for (now unified — deploy no longer inlines the tls path), and create/add/clone. - ensure_dirs raises an actionable CastleDirError instead of a bare PermissionError; the api surfaces it as 422. - doctor: "data dir writable" check + WARN when CASTLE_DATA_DIR/REPOS_DIR env overrides the file (the one remaining cross-process divergence vector). - install.sh persists data_dir/repos_dir into castle.yaml (idempotent, non-default). - Docs: registry.md globals + AGENTS.md roots.
